Albany algebra tutors can help students with homework assignments. At a very basic level, this can be useful in taking away some stress for students and parents, but it's far more important than that. Unlike other subjects in school, algebra proficiency has much less to do with memorization than it does with understanding the process. Working together on homework assignments allows instructors an opportunity to work through the mechanics of solving problems with your student, explaining how it works and helping them course correct, offering feedback in the moment and preventing mistakes from becoming bad habits.
Albany algebra tutoring can be customized to your student's learning preferences. Different instruction styles can resonate better with certain students, and as your student's instructor gets to know them, they can adapt their approach to better reach your student. For example, if your student is more visually oriented, demonstrating how a problem is solved using the virtual whiteboard function on the Live Learning Platform can be useful. If your student is more of an aural learner, incorporation of cadence tactics can be useful in helping them remember things like the quadratic equation. For students who are competitive, things like timed practice tests can help drive improved performance. These sorts of customized approaches can make sessions more effective.
